Mott MacDonald is looking for a construction professional to join our ever-expanding transportation team in Southern California. Specifically, we are looking for a qualified Assistant Resident Engineer .
- Have knowledge of and assist RE and Metro for day-to-day Station construction issues and other RE tasks as needed.
- Review and comprehend specifications and generate list of submittals/materials/Metro obligations for upcoming work, including third party obligations.
- Review project site and progress work
- Coordinate with Lead/field inspection staff on a daily basis; discuss field issues and reports.
- Review daily summaries.
- Review quantity tracking log and labor tracking.
- Identify any cost or schedule impact, and in review of inspection reports developed
- Update project stations issues log.
- Review and check tracking logs.
- Review weekly internal stations presentation.
- Assist RE with monthly schedule update reviews and provide comments.
- Provide a list of change order update activities to the inspectors.
- Meet with OE on a weekly basis and provide guidance.
- Verify as-built information on the contractor’s three week look ahead schedule and review weekly look ahead meeting minutes.
- Generate draft of weekly summary narrative.
- Review all applicable Submittals, RFI’s, etc.
- Assist Contractor/Quality team to facilitate resolution and closure of Non-Conformance (NC’s) in a timely manner.
- Participate in Readiness Reviews and pre-construction meetings
- Ensure construction work plans are in place for upcoming work along with appropriate submittals.
- Assist Resident Engineer in drafting responses to correspondences.
- Perform technical/contractual analysis of contract change orders, draft scope, and contractual basis for Resident Engineer review.
- Review potential change requests and provisional sum agreement (PSA) requests for merit.
- Review change order log / PSA log on a weekly basis and track progress.
- Ensure that OE is maintaining organized files for change orders / PSA's.
- Review Materials on Hand packages every month.
- Assist RE with monthly progress payment recommendations.
- Resolve construction issues as needed.
- Attend instrumentation meetings and identify/resolve any issues; elevate to RE as needed.
- Coordinate/resolve any third-party or community relations issues or claims.
- Coordinate with environmental group for environmental issues.
- Other duties as assigned by the Construction Manager (Design-Build).
